National League One
Blaydon 17
Cinderford 20
CHRISTMAS came late for Cinderford as they celebrated their second consecutive league victory with the festive party that never was.
Santa hats and horrible jumpers were the post-match attire as Andy Deacon's men hit the town with something to shout about.
Cinderford made the long journey to the north east on Friday evening, not arriving until 12.30am on Saturday.
They were without Adam Nicholls (back injury), so Mark Rimmer came into the second-row with Dave McKee switching to blindside flanker.
Danny Trigg opened the scoring with a penalty, before missing two tough shots at goal.
Blaydon, always a tough nut to crack at home, seized the initiative with a 28th minute try from centre Patrick Dias, converted by Andrew Baggett.
Mark Davies dropped a goal in the 35th minute, but the hosts took a 10-6 lead into the interval when Baggett kicked a penalty.
Cinderford came out strongly in the second-half and winger Nevaro Codlin raced in for his eighth try of the season just five minutes after the restart. Codlin collected an inside pass from Dave Knight before cutting past full-back Rock with ease. Trigg converted from close to the posts.
Back came Blaydon – flanker Rob Bell going over for a try that Baggett converted.
Cinderford thought they had scored the decisive try when Dave Knight ghosted over the line. His team-mates were already celebrating when Blaydon lock Gavin Jones forced the careless Knight to knock-on in the in-goal area.
Knight made amends soon after. He charged down an attempted clearance from Baggett, gathered up the loose ball and made no mistake grounding the ball this time. Trigg converted.
With a quarter-of-an hour to play Blaydon pressed hard for another score, but they were shut out by some determined defending as the Foresters introduced fresh legs in Chris Jones, Sam Wilkes and Steve Price.
